The Effect of Temperature on Paint Application
When you're planning an industrial exterior paint project, the temperature can considerably impact just how well the paint adheres and dries.
Ideally, you intend to repaint when temperature levels vary in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F. If it's too chilly, the paint might not cure correctly, bring about concerns like peeling off or breaking.
On the other side, if it's as well hot, the paint can dry as well rapidly, stopping proper attachment and causing an uneven finish.

Constantly check the supplier's referrals for the details paint you're making use of, as they often offer support on the optimal temperature level variety for optimum outcomes.
Humidity and Its Result on Drying Times
Temperature isn't the only ecological element that affects your business exterior painting job; humidity plays a substantial role also. High moisture levels can reduce drying out times significantly, influencing the overall quality of your paint task.
When the air is saturated with dampness, the paint takes longer to cure, which can result in concerns like inadequate bond and a greater risk of mold development. If you're repainting on an especially moist day, be gotten ready for extended delay times between layers.
It's critical to keep track of neighborhood weather and plan accordingly. Ideally, aim for humidity degrees between 40% and 70% for optimal drying.
Maintaining these consider mind guarantees your job stays on track and supplies a lasting coating.
